A quiet community in Malaybalay City has been plunged into shock and mourning after the body of a nine-year-old girl, who had been missing for days, was discovered Friday morning, April 17, 2026, prompting authorities to launch an intensified manhunt for the suspect.

The victim, identified as Archel Licayan, was found at around 10:00 a.m. in Sitio Incalbog, Barangay Can-ayan. Initial police reports said the child had been reported missing as early as April 14. Her lifeless body was discovered stuffed inside a sack and abandoned along a riverbank, a detail that has further deepened outrage among residents.

Family members, including her grandparents, were the first to identify the remains. They are reportedly devastated by the brutal loss, as the community rallies to support them in their grief.

The Malaybalay City Police Station immediately launched a hot pursuit operation following the discovery. Authorities are now working closely with neighboring local government units and other law enforcement agencies to establish the circumstances surrounding the killing, including a timeline and possible motive. Investigators are treating the case as a violent crime and have begun forensic examinations, while also gathering witness statements that may help identify and locate the perpetrator.

Local officials have identified a person of interest believed to be a resident of Barangay Alanib in Lantapan, Bukidnon. According to information shared by authorities, the individual reportedly has a previous murder case on record in the same municipality. Police have tightened monitoring of possible exit routes and are pursuing multiple leads to prevent the suspect from evading arrest.
